Project Altmark

Conversion from pine-dominated forest to biodiverse mixed forest

 142 ha in Saxony-Anhalt
18,552 t CO₂

Project Description and Activities

In the climate project 'Altmark', over 140 hectares of pine- and larch-dominated forest in Saxony-Anhalt are being converted into a near-natural, biodiverse mixed forest. By doing so, the project avoids and removes over 18,000 tons of CO₂ emission over 30 years from the atmosphere, preparing the forest for future climatic conditions.

Project activities such as the promotion of natural regeneration, the introduction of new species such as English oak, Douglas fir, maple and mountain elm, mixture regulation and adapted wildlife management make the forest more resistant to the consequences of climate change such as storms, drought and beetle infestation.

Why we need forest adaptation

Forest fires

Wind plays a decisive role in the development of forest fires. In row-planted monocultures, the wind can easily push the fire through the stand, which leads to a faster spread of forest fires.

Storms

Forest areas with many tall and thin trees are more susceptible to storm damage (so-called windthrow). If, in addition, most of the trees in a section of forest are the same height, storms can lead to the loss of entire forest sections.
